I think you need to push a revert commit. so pull from github again, including the commit you want to revert, then use git revert and push the result. if you don't care about other people's clones of your github repository being broken, you can also delete and recreate the master branch on github after your reset: git push origin :master.

Don't forget to do a git fetch all prune on other machines after deleting the remote branch on the server. ||| after deleting the local branch with git branch d and deleting the remote branch with git push origin delete other machines may still have "obsolete tracking branches" (to see them do git branch a). to get rid of these do git fetch all prune.
